
Renamed the database to .git/annex/keysdb; the old .git/annex/keys gets deleted during the upgrade. It is possible that an old git-annex process is running during the upgrade. If so, it will be able to continue using the old keys db until the upgrade is complete, and then will presumably fail in some ugly way. Or perhaps the upgrade will be unable to delete the open files on some systems, and so fail with an ugly error message. It's also possible for multiple processes to be running the upgrade concurrently. That should be fine; they will both write the same information into the keys db. Other databases still need to be upgraded.
